首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

获取运行应用程序的文件路径(不是可执行文件)?

获取运行应用程序的文件路径(不是可执行文件)可以通过以下方式实现:

在前端开发中,由于浏览器的安全限制,无法直接获取运行应用程序的文件路径。但可以通过input标签的file类型,让用户选择文件后获取文件的路径。例如,使用HTML的input标签和JavaScript的File API可以实现文件选择和获取文件路径的功能。

在后端开发中,可以使用不同的编程语言和框架来获取运行应用程序的文件路径。以下是一些常见的示例:

  1. 在Python中,可以使用__file__变量来获取当前脚本的文件路径。例如:
代码语言:txt
复制
import os
current_path = os.path.dirname(os.path.abspath(__file__))
  1. 在Java中,可以使用System.getProperty("user.dir")来获取当前工作目录的路径。例如:
代码语言:txt
复制
String currentPath = System.getProperty("user.dir");
  1. 在Node.js中,可以使用__dirname变量来获取当前模块的文件路径。例如:
代码语言:txt
复制
const path = require('path');
const currentPath = path.resolve(__dirname);

以上是一些常见的获取运行应用程序文件路径的方法,具体的实现方式会根据不同的开发语言和框架而有所不同。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券